One-to-many uni-directional with a join-table is required in cases where
your "Image" doesn't need to be aware of your "User".

I prefer doing it this way because it reduces entities inter-dependencies.

Marco Pivetta

http://twitter.com/Ocramius

http://ocramius.github.com/

On 10 November 2014 11:59, Javier Garcia <[email protected]> wrote:

> Thanks Parsifal! could you tell one case when should I use "One-To-Many,
> Unidirectional with Join Table"?
>
> El lunes, 10 de noviembre de 2014 11:36:19 UTC+1, Parsifal escribió:
>>
>>
>> If each photo belongs to one user only, better to have OneToMany
>> (User->Photos) Bidirectional.
>>
>>
>> On Mon, Nov 10, 2014 at 1:38 PM, Javier Garcia <[email protected]>
>> wrote:
>>
>>> Hi,
>>>
>>> I need a relationship that fits this: one user (User class) can have
>>> many photos.
>>>
>>> What mapping should I use? "One-To-Many, Unidirectional with Join Table"?
>>>
>>>  --
>>> You received this message because you are subscribed to the Google
>>> Groups "doctrine-user" group.
>>> To unsubscribe from this group and stop receiving emails from it, send
>>> an email to [email protected].
>>> To post to this group, send email to [email protected].
>>> Visit this group at http://groups.google.com/group/doctrine-user.
>>> For more options, visit https://groups.google.com/d/optout.
>>>
>>
>>  --
> You received this message because you are subscribed to the Google Groups
> "doctrine-user" group.
> To unsubscribe from this group and stop receiving emails from it, send an
> email to [email protected].
> To post to this group, send email to [email protected].
> Visit this group at http://groups.google.com/group/doctrine-user.
> For more options, visit https://groups.google.com/d/optout.
>

-- 
You received this message because you are subscribed to the Google Groups 
"doctrine-user"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/doctrine-user.
For more options, visit https://groups.google.com/d/optout.

Reply via email to